A simple capillary zone electrophoresis method for the determination of mycophenolic acid in human plasma

摘要 Mycophenolic acid (MPA), an immunosuppressive drug, was determined in human plasma by a simple capillary zone electrophoresis (CZE) method. A bare fused-silica capillary with an internal diameter (i.d.) of 75/am and an effective length of 50 cm was used for the separation. A 200 }aL plasma sample was deproteinized with 400 μL acetonitrile, and the supematant was directly injected into the capillary after a water plug at a pressure of 0.5 psi for 10 s. Boric acid (H3BO3, 200 mmol/L) solution adjusted to a pH of 8.60 with 1 mol/L sodium hydroxide (NaOH) solution was selected as the background electrolyte (BGE) through a uniform design. Calibration curve established on each day was linear over the MPA concentration range of 0.625-30.0 Bg/mL in human plasma with the correlation coefficient (r) larger than 0.9997. The limit of detection (LOD) was 0.200 ~tg/mL. Intra- and inter-day precisions at three concentrations within the calibration range were less than 4.45%. Plasma samples collected from 14 renal transplant recipients treated with the prodrug mycophenolate mofetil (MMF) were analyzed successfully by both the developed CZE technique and a validated high-performance liquid chromatography-tandem mass spectrometry (HPLC-MS/MS) technique. The mean absolute and relative differences between the concentrations measured by the two methods were -0.17 and -0.20%, respectively. In conclusion, the CZE method described here was validated to be accurate, precise, and economical for the clinical quantification of MPA. 建立了人血浆中麦考酚酸浓度的毛细管区带电泳测定法。200μL的血浆样品经400μL的乙腈沉淀蛋白后,紧接一段水柱进样,进样量为:0.5 psi×10 s。分离采用内径75μm,有效长度50 cm的未涂层熔硅弹性石英毛细管柱。通过均匀设计实验,选定pH为8.60的硼酸缓冲液(硼酸初始浓度为200 mmol/L)为背景缓冲液。结果显示,测定方法的标准曲线在0.625~30.0μg/mL的范围内,r平均值大于0.9997;检测下限为0.200μg/mL;日内、日间精密度均小于4.45%。应用本方法和高效液相色谱-串联质谱法,对14份接受麦考酚酸酯治疗的肾移植术后患者的血样进行分析,表明本方法准确、精密、经济,对于麦考酚酸的临床定量极具价值。
